Christianity. It's a very triggering word in today's climate. You either embrace, hate it, or have completely walked away from it. But what if you could find a way to make it work for you, in a way that says, " I can be Christian and LGBTQIA? Joining the conversation today, is Rev. Brandan Robertson. A progressive Gay Christian, who call us to wake up and take action for the collective good in the ways of Jesus--challenging and inspiring all to believe that a just world is on the horizon. About Rev. Brandan Rev. Brandan Robertson is a noted author, activist, and public theologian working at the intersections of spirituality, sexuality, and social renewal. He currently serves as the Pastor of Metanoia Church, a digital progressive faith community and is the host of The Big Questions Podcast. A prolific writer, he is the author of seven books on spirituality, justice, and theology, including the INDIES Book of the Year Award Finalist True Inclusion: Creating Communities of Radical Embrace.
